Ingredients

Instructions

  1. Step 1: Preheat oven to 375°F. In a bowl, mix 12 oz ground beef, 1/4 cup oatmeal, 1/4 cup diced onion, 1 minced garlic clove, 2 tbsp ketchup, 1 tbsp Worcestershire sauce, 1/4 tsp salt, and 1/8 tsp black pepper until just combined—avoid overmixing.
  2. Step 2: Press mixture into a greased loaf pan and spread 1 tbsp maple syrup evenly over the top. Bake for 45 minutes until internal temperature reaches 160°F.
  3. Step 3: While meatloaf bakes, toss 12 oz cubed sweet potatoes with 1 tbsp olive oil, 1/4 tsp salt, and 1/8 tsp black pepper. Roast on a separate sheet for 25-30 minutes until fork-tender and golden at the edges.

How do I store leftover The Ultimate Comfort Meatloaf with Maple-Topped Sweet Potatoes?

Cool to room temperature within 2 hours, then store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days. Reheat covered in a 350°F oven for 10-12 minutes, or microwave at 70% power in 60-second bursts to keep ground beef from drying out.

How do I scale The Ultimate Comfort Meatloaf with Maple-Topped Sweet Potatoes for a different number of people?

The recipe is written for 4 servings. Multiply each ingredient by (your serving target / 4). Cook time stays roughly the same up to 2x; for 3-4x batches, switch from a skillet to a sheet pan or stockpot so the food isn't crowded — overcrowding steams instead of browns.
